The wildcard warning uses
status-warningstyling for what is an exciting/experimental feature, not a danger state. Yellow warning styling signals 'something could go wrong' — a friction point for users with anxiety or demand avoidance.Fix: Change wrapper to neutral
card-secondary. Reframe: 'Wildcard mode lets the AI get creative with whatever you have on hand. Results might surprise you.'Refs: MED-N8
